Recently I had the pleasure of working with a 13 year old junior high student. The goal was to create a more organized backpack and a better system for getting assignments turned in. I turned to The Organized Student by Donna Goldberg for guidance.
I was impressed by this book and actually think that all parents and students should check it out! Your student will learn lessons early that will last a lifetime.
It was interesting and fun for me to read because I believe that organizing principles are universal, such as labeling everything and having a system. However, it was still very fun and interesting to see how to apply those SPECIFICALLY to backpacks and binders and get some helpful tips that I may or may not thought of on my own.
